Lines 2-8
Link Here
|
2 |
# Distributed under the terms of the GNU General Public License v2 |
2 |
# Distributed under the terms of the GNU General Public License v2 |
3 |
# $Header: /var/cvsroot/gentoo-x86/sys-apps/powerpc-utils/powerpc-utils-1.1.3.18-r1.ebuild,v 1.2 2009/04/17 14:47:46 ranger Exp $ |
3 |
# $Header: /var/cvsroot/gentoo-x86/sys-apps/powerpc-utils/powerpc-utils-1.1.3.18-r1.ebuild,v 1.2 2009/04/17 14:47:46 ranger Exp $ |
4 |
|
4 |
|
5 |
inherit eutils versionator |
5 |
inherit eutils versionator toolchain-funcs |
6 |
|
6 |
|
7 |
BASEVER=$(get_version_component_range 1-3) |
7 |
BASEVER=$(get_version_component_range 1-3) |
8 |
DEBREV=$(get_version_component_range 4) |
8 |
DEBREV=$(get_version_component_range 4) |
Lines 25-36
Link Here
|
25 |
src_unpack() { |
25 |
src_unpack() { |
26 |
unpack ${A} |
26 |
unpack ${A} |
27 |
cd ${S} |
27 |
cd ${S} |
28 |
epatch ${WORKDIR}/${PN}_${BASEVER}-${DEBREV}.diff |
28 |
epatch "${WORKDIR}/${PN}_${BASEVER}-${DEBREV}.diff" |
29 |
epatch ${WORKDIR}/${PN}-cleanup.patch |
29 |
epatch "${WORKDIR}/${PN}-cleanup.patch" |
|
|
30 |
epatch "${FILESDIR}/${P}-compiler.patch" |
30 |
} |
31 |
} |
31 |
|
32 |
|
32 |
src_compile() { |
33 |
src_compile() { |
33 |
emake CFLAGS="$CFLAGS -fsigned-char -D_GNU_SOURCE" || die |
34 |
tc-export CC |
|
|
35 |
emake || die |
34 |
} |
36 |
} |
35 |
|
37 |
|
36 |
src_install() { |
38 |
src_install() { |